The Eanes ISD board of trustees unanimously approved the elementary health curriculum for the 2023-24 school year at a meeting April 25, as recommended by the School Safety and Health Advisory Committee.
The curriculum will be provided by QuaverEd, an education technology company, and will consist of 196 lessons for grades K-5. Lessons will address four different dimensions of student health, including intellectual, physical, social and emotional health.
The QuaverEd curriculum is used by over 150 school districts throughout the state of Texas.
